Buffy Summers and her Slayer army have suffered heavy losses
throughout Season Eight and faced scores of threats new and
old, but the one mystery connecting it all has been the
identity of the Big Bad Twilight! In this penultimate volume
of Season Eight, New York Times bestselling novelist and
comics writer Brad Meltzer (The Book of Lies, Identity
Crisis) joins series artist Georges Jeanty in beginning the
buildup to the season finale in the story line that finally
reveals the identity of Twilight! In the aftermath of the
battle with Twilight's army, Buffy has developed a host of
new powers, but when will the other shoe drop, and will it
be a cute shoe, or an ugly one? Still reeling from the
losses of war, Willow goes looking for missing allies, and
discovers a horrifying truth about several of the Slayer
army's recent ordeals. Adding to the mayhem is the
unexpected return of Angel, in his Season Eight debut! This
volume also features two stories from series creator and
executive producer Joss Whedon! In the Willow one-shot,
Whedon and Fray artist Karl Moline reveal for the first time
what Buffy's witchy best friend was up to between Seasons
Seven and Eight, with a mind-blowing cameo by a frequently
requested character. And in "Turbulence," Joss spotlights
the complicated relationship between Buffy and Xander with a
conversation that changes it forever.
